Legendary actor Jackie Shroff filed a case in Delhi High Court to have his publicity rights and reputation safeguarded. Without his permission, the complaint has been brought against multiple businesses that have used his voice, images, name, and phrase “Bhidu.” A lawsuit has been brought against the companies that are exploiting Jackie Shroff for profit without his consent. It is anticipated that the court will rule in this case shortly, allowing the actor’s publicity rights to be protected.

Additional Bollywood actors who requested publicity rights from the court

Bollywood actors have already asked the court for assistance in defending their rights to privacy and publicity. Legendary actor Amitabh Bachchan has already filed a petition with the Mumbai High Court to prohibit impersonation and unauthorized use of his voice. However, Anil Kapoor also filed a case with the Delhi High Court last year to defend his rights to his personality. Furthermore, Anil won the case in January and requested that his name, voice, speech pattern, likeness, picture, and gestures as well as the catchphrase “jhakaas” be protected.
